Tile drain replacement services involve removing old or damaged tile drains and installing new drainage systems to improve water flow around a property. This process typically includes excavating sections of existing tile lines, inspecting the condition of the underground pipes, and replacing any sections that are cracked, clogged, or collapsed. The goal is to restore proper drainage, prevent water from pooling in unwanted areas, and ensure that excess moisture is efficiently directed away from the foundation or landscape. Experienced service providers can handle both the removal of outdated tile drains and the installation of new systems that meet the specific needs of each property.
These services help address common drainage issues such as standing water in yards, soggy lawns, or water seepage into basements and crawl spaces. Poor drainage can lead to soil erosion, landscape damage, and even structural problems over time. Tile drain replacement can also be a solution for properties experiencing frequent flooding after heavy rains or for those with poorly functioning drainage systems that no longer effectively manage excess water. By replacing aging or damaged tile drains, homeowners can improve their property's overall drainage performance and reduce the risk of water-related issues.
Tile drain replacement is often needed on residential properties, especially in areas with clay soils or properties situated on slopes where water tends to collect or flow improperly. It is also common in properties with landscaping that has been altered or expanded, which can disrupt existing drainage pathways. Farms, large estates, and commercial properties may also require tile drain replacement to maintain proper water management across extensive land areas. The overview below groups typical Tile Drain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Kennesaw, GA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or tile drain repairs or replacements in Kennesaw range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for straightforward repairs or partial replacements. Larger or more complex projects can exceed this range, but are less common.
Full Tile Drain Replacement - Complete replacements for residential properties often cost between $1,200 and $3,500. Most local contractors handle projects in this range, with fewer jobs reaching higher amounts due to added complexity or extensive work.
Large or Complex Installations - Larger projects, such as extensive drainage system overhauls, can cost $4,000 or more. These tend to be less frequent and involve significant excavation or custom work, which increases overall costs.
Additional Factors - Costs can vary based on soil conditions, accessibility, and the extent of existing damage. Contact local pros to get precise estimates tailored to specific project needs in Kennesaw and surrounding areas.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
